How to Move to Oracle PBCS

What is Oracle PBCS?

Oracle PBCS is a subscription-based planning and budgeting solution built for and deployed on Oracle Cloud, using a proven, flexible, best-in-class architecture for the planning and reporting. It offers immediate value and greater productivity for business planners, analysts, modelers, and decision-makers across all lines of business within an enterprise.

Oracle PBCS is built to scale and perform, using industry-standard Oracle Cloud infrastructure. The key highlights are:

Oracle PBCS Pricing

Data centers or cloud servers where PBCS is hosted are owned and maintained by Oracle. Since there is no CAPEX infrastructure cost, virtually no learning curve, and minimal IT resources are required, the PBCS solution can be used by a company of any size. The cost structure for the PBCS is a per user per month license.

Maintenance Costs

Software versions are always up-to-date and maintained by Oracle, allowing clients to the latest and greatest version without requiring any downtime to upgrade. Oracle provides the test and production environments for every PBCS implementation. Oracle updates test environments first and then gives notice when updates are planned, what the changes are, and the issues that are resolved in the new version.

Loading Data

Financial Data Quality Management Enterprise Edition (FDMEE) is also part of the Planning and Budgeting Cloud and is used to load data to planning BSO (block storage) and ASO (aggregate storage) cubes. Planning data can be moved from the BSO to ASO cubes and other reporting data can also be loaded to ASO cubes directly. Data in PBCS can also be loaded through EPM Automate, a utility that enables you to automate certain common administrative tasks.

MOVING TO ORACLE PBCS 

Ultimately, if you are considering the Oracle PBCS, you are either targeting a new implementation or a migration from on-premises (or hosted) to the cloud – Oracle calls this a ‘lift and shift’.

New Implementation Highlights and Considerations are: 

• Eliminate normal start-up activities: 

    o Hardware procurement and setup 

    o Software procurement, install, and base configurations 

• Access is provided in days with the new subscription 

• Leverage new application wizard and configure the applications

• Focus on the data and FDMEE upfront, then functionality 

• Can be accomplished in a few months

  o Dependent on availability of requirements, a number of applications and    their design complexity, the extent of data integration needed, and end-user  (superuser) involvement Lift and Shift Highlights and Considerations: 

• Investigate the Oracle’s Customer to the Cloud program 

• Pre-built modules (e.g. CapEx, etc.) do not yet port 

• You may need to change the data integration approach 

     o Shift to simplified, file-based approach 

• Regression testing is still needed 

• Can be accomplished in weeks

      o Again, this is dependent on the number of applications and their complexity, components needing testing (reports, forms, etc.), the extent of data integration changes needed, and the availability of regression test scripts.
